The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711/1A-018 Tiffany Edition is a highly coveted limited-edition timepiece released to celebrate 170 years of partnership with Tiffany & Co.The limited-edition Nautilus 5711, featuring Tiffany’s signature robin’s-egg blue dial, became a flashpoint in luxury retail, with customers spending millions on jewelry in hopes of securing one of only 170 coveted watches priced at $52,635.

What is the resale value of a 5711?
Patek Philippe 5711 Retail Price vs. Today, it sells for more than USD 100,000 in the secondary market. The price hasn’t risen steadily. The blue dial 5711/1A-010 reached its peak at USD 131,504 in 2022. Now it has settled around USD 89,404 – still three times its original price. From its debut until its discontinuation in 2021, Patek Philippe introduced numerous iterations of the 5711, exploring precious metals, diverse dial hues, mechanical innovations, and more.
How much is a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711 worth?
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711 Price and Investment Value A steel 5711/1A can trade for well over $100,000, while precious metal versions command even higher figures.
